Release Policy
Release Shape
MicroClaw releases from tagged commits (v*).
Each release should have:
- green required CI jobs
- generated release notes
- packaged binaries for supported platforms
- upgrade notes when migrations or config changes are involved
- rollback instructions recorded in the PR or release checklist
Supported Platforms
Current release asset target set:
- Linux x86_64
- macOS x86_64
- macOS arm64
- Windows x86_64
If a target is temporarily missing, the release notes should say so explicitly.
Release Gates
Release candidates should satisfy:

- release asset packaging smoke
Rollback Standard
Every release should preserve:
- previous binary or package availability
- DB backup instructions
- the release commit SHA
- the effective config diff or migration note
If request success, scheduler recoverability, or auth boundaries regress, pause release rollout and revert to the last known good release.
